  1. Choose Your Kettlebells

    Start by selecting the right kettlebells for your fitness level. Beginners might want to start with lighter weights (e.g., 8-12 kg for men, 4-8 kg for women), while more advanced users can opt for heavier ones.

  2. Define Your Goals

    What do you want to achieve? Are you looking to lose weight, build strength, or improve your overall fitness? Setting clear goals will help you tailor your iron burn session plan to meet your specific needs.

  3. Create a Workout Schedule

    Consistency is key. Plan your workouts around your schedule, aiming for at least 3-4 sessions per week. Each session should include a mix of strength, cardio, and mobility exercises.

  4. Structure Your Sessions

    A typical iron burn session plan might look like this:

    • Warm-Up (5-10 minutes): Start with dynamic stretches and light kettlebell swings to get your blood flowing.
    • Main Workout (30-40 minutes): Focus on high-intensity circuits, including kettlebell swings, goblet squats, and Turkish get-ups.
    • Cool-Down (5-10 minutes): Finish with static stretches and deep breathing to help your body recover.
  5. Track Your Progress

    Keep a workout log to track your progress. Note the weights you use, the number of reps, and how you feel after each session. This will help you adjust your plan as needed and stay motivated.

FAQs: Common Questions Answered

How often should I do kettlebell workouts?
For optimal results, aim for 3-4 sessions per week, with at least one rest day between workouts to allow for recovery.
Can I still do kettlebell workouts if I have a busy schedule?
Absolutely! Kettlebell workouts are highly efficient and can be done in as little as 20-30 minutes. Plus, you can easily do them at home or in a small space.
Do I need to buy different sized kettlebells?
Having a few different sizes can be beneficial, but it’s not necessary. Start with one or two that fit your current fitness level, and you can always add more as you progress.
What if I’m not seeing results?
Consistency is key. Stick with your iron burn session plan for at least 4-6 weeks before expecting significant changes. If you’re still not seeing results, consider adjusting your plan or consulting with a fitness professional.
